How can I reduce maintenance while supporting local ecology?

Replacing high-maintenance turf areas with native plantings like Purple Coneflower, Little Bluestem, Butterfly Milkweed, and Wild Bergamot creates resilient landscapes requiring minimal inputs. These species thrive in Republic's acidic silt loam soils and support pollinator populations year-round. Transitioning to electric maintenance equipment aligns with evolving noise ordinance considerations while eliminating fossil fuel emissions. Native plant communities establish deeper root systems that improve soil structure and require 75% less water than conventional turf once established.

What solutions address moderate runoff problems in my yard?

Acidic silt loam soils with clay-pan subsoil create moderate runoff issues by limiting percolation rates. Installing permeable Ozark limestone paver systems allows surface water to infiltrate rather than run off, meeting Republic Planning & Development Department standards for stormwater management. French drains or dry creek beds with gravel bases provide additional drainage pathways. These solutions work with the soil's natural pH 6.0-6.5 characteristics while preventing erosion and water pooling in low-lying areas.

How do I maintain Tall Fescue turf during dry periods without violating water restrictions?

Wi-Fi ET-based weather sensing irrigation systems calculate evapotranspiration rates using local weather data, applying water only when needed. This technology maintains Tall Fescue health while conserving 20-40% more water than traditional timer-based systems. Republic currently operates under Stage 0 water restrictions, but ET-based systems prepare landscapes for potential future restrictions by optimizing every irrigation cycle. These systems automatically adjust for rainfall, soil moisture, and temperature fluctuations specific to USDA Zone 6b conditions.

Why does my Brookline yard have drainage issues and compacted soil?

Republic's Brookline neighborhood was primarily developed around 1995, giving soils approximately 31 years to mature. Acidic silt loam soils common in this area tend to compact over time, especially with clay-pan subsoil layers that restrict water movement. Core aeration every 1-2 years improves soil permeability by reducing compaction and enhancing oxygen exchange. Incorporating organic amendments like composted leaf mold increases water retention while maintaining the optimal pH 6.0-6.5 range for most landscape plants.

What invasive species should I watch for and how do I manage them safely?

Japanese honeysuckle and wintercreeper present significant invasive risks in Republic's USDA Zone 6b, outcompeting native vegetation. Manual removal followed by targeted herbicide application during active growth periods controls these species effectively. Always follow Missouri Department of Agriculture regulations regarding herbicide use, particularly phosphorus runoff mitigation requirements. Treatment timing avoids local fertilizer ordinance blackout dates while ensuring maximum efficacy with minimal environmental impact.

Why choose limestone over wood for patios and walkways?

Ozark limestone pavers offer superior longevity with minimal maintenance compared to wood, which requires regular sealing and replacement. Limestone's natural thermal mass moderates temperature extremes while providing non-combustible surfaces that support Republic's Moderate Firewise USA Community Standards. These pavers create defensible space around structures without contributing to fire risk. Their natural variation in color and texture integrates seamlessly with native plantings while withstanding freeze-thaw cycles common in Missouri's climate.
